46 minutes ago, MrAlien said:

if UNT made the Sweet 16, I think Hodge and the coaching staff would be poached by other programs rather quickly.    

It's going to take more than that. Look at Dusty May, Shaka Smart at VCU, and Brad Stevens at Butler. May is still at FAU after a F4 appearance. Smart and Stevens took years of success to get hired away. Regardless, a good problem to have.

So far I think he has done well recruiting, on paper this is a very strong team.  We know he can coach the defensive side of the ball, its been said he was the architect of the defense under Mac.  Assuming he can get the players to buy into his system then I think this team could be tournament bound in March.

Getting to the Sweet 16... The AAC should be a multi bid conference, and the lowest seeded team would probably be a 12 seed at worst.  Which means the match ups should be winnable in the first 2 rounds, so very possible that UNT could reach the Sweet 16.
